Abstract:
New applications in bio-Imaging, material processing and time-resolved molecular spectroscopy require new high-power Laser sources in the near- and mid-infrared spectral regions. High power femtosecond Lasers based on optical parametric chirped-pulse amplifiers (OPCPA) pumped by recent material processing lasers offer average powers up to 100 W and support pulse durations down to the few-cycle regime.
In my presentation, I will give an overview about different laser architectures based on OPCPA. The high single-pass gain and low absorption of the nonlinear amplifier crystals offer a robust set-up on a compact footprint. In addition, the broad amplification bandwidth and our white-light generation enable tunable Laser sources in wavelength regions between 350 nm and 3500 nm. We reduce complexity and increase stability to provide easy-to-use femtosecond lasers and to enable our customers to target new frontiers in ultrafast applications.
